Qumin.ai is an innovative AI-driven testing platform designed to simplify end-to-end web and mobile app testing. By translating plain-English requirements into self-healing test scripts, it eliminates the need for brittle selectors and ongoing test maintenance. This tool is ideal for QA teams, developers, and product managers seeking rapid, reliable test automation without deep scripting knowledge. Its standout feature is the ability to generate, execute, and repair tests automatically within a minute, significantly accelerating the testing cycle and reducing manual effort. Currently supporting web and Android, with plans to expand, Qumin.ai aims to make quality assurance more accessible and efficient through AI-powered automation that adapts to evolving applications.

Unabyss for Claude is a groundbreaking tool designed to enhance the capabilities of AI language models by offering shared memory across multiple applications and LLMs. It allows Claude to access and recall context from various sources like email, Google Drive, GitHub, Notion, and meeting recordings, creating a unified memory that improves AI interactions and productivity. Unlike traditional integrations that require manual wiring of each app, Unabyss automates the process, ensuring Claude stays updated with all relevant information in real-time. This results in more accurate, context-aware responses that truly understand your business and personal workflows. Perfect for teams and individuals seeking seamless AI collaboration, Unabyss makes AI smarter, more private, and portable by maintaining a persistent, secure memory foundation that follows users across different platforms and tools.
